This map has a bit of a chaotic start where you quickly have to defend against invaders before you claim the portal and then deal with skeleton/bile demon infighting, but after that it is a pretty standard DzjeeAr map. You get the prison later in the game, massive parties filled with lvl10 samurai spawn and in the end you've got to defend against some very OP-Knights. This map you get no bridge and you face some ranged heroes in long lava-mazes, but I worked my way around that by casting Armageddon. Not a bad map at all if you like big fights.
